概述graphic图表中提供了自定义tooltip的事件,可通过selections中on和clear配置手势选项和可识别设备,默认情况下tooltip需要双击隐藏,但这并不符合我们的需求。通过调研发现,若想实现tooltip隔几秒后隐藏,可通过StreamController向chart发送订阅流事件隐藏,这感觉更像是局部刷新实现import'dart:async';import'package:flutter/material.dart';classChartWidgetextendsStatefulWidget{constChartWidget({super.key});@overrid
文章目录在Unity中,ToolTip是一个在编辑器中使用的UI元素,它提供了鼠标悬停在某个对象或控件上时显示的文本信息。ToolTip通常用于向开发人员提供有关对象、字段、控件或菜单项的附加信息,从而帮助他们更好地理解和使用这些元素。ToolTip通常以短文本的形式出现,当用户将鼠标悬停在一个可显示ToolTip的对象上时,它会在一段时间后自动出现,向用户显示相关的说明、指导或警告。ToolTip是一个常见的用户界面元素,有助于提供即时的上下文信息,减少用户对不熟悉元素的疑惑。在Unity编辑器中,ToolTip可以用于以下方面:字段和属性:在脚本中的公开(public)字段或属性上添加[T
我可以将一些消息设置为显示为TextView或Button的“工具提示”吗? 最佳答案 在触摸屏上没有“悬停”的概念,但你可以设置一个LongClickListener为您的View,并有一个Toast长按后出现。像这样:ToastviewToast=Toast.makeText(this,"MyViewTooltip",Toast.LENGTH_SHORT);ViewmyView=(View)findViewById(R.id.my_view);myView.setOnLongClickListener(newOnLongClic
这里给大家分享我在网上总结出来的一些知识,希望对大家有所帮助前言日常开发中,我们经常遇到过tooltip这种需求。文字溢出、产品文案、描述说明等等,每次都需要写一大串代码,那么有没有一种简单的方式呢,这回我们用指令来试试。功能特性支持tooltip样式自定义支持tooltip内容自定义动态更新tooltip内容文字省略自动出提示支持弹窗位置自定义和偏移功能实现在vue3中,指令也是拥有着对应的生命周期。 我们这里需要使用的是 mounted、updated和unmounted钩子。import{DirectiveBinding}from'vue'exportdefault{mounted(el
又是一个好几天的bug,可能是由于elementui版本网上很多方案不通,解决show-overflow-tooltip显示过长的问题el-table-columnwidth="240"prop="workSummary"header-align="center"align="center"label="工作总结"> template#default="scope">el-tooltipeffect="dark"placement="top">template#content>divclass="set-popper">{{scope.row.workSummary}}/div>/templa
第一部分:echarts鼠标放上去显示提示框属性详解tooltip={//提示框组件trigger:'item',//触发类型,'item'数据项图形触发,主要在散点图,饼图等无类目轴的图表中使用。'axis'坐标轴触发,主要在柱状图,折线图等会使用类目轴的图表中使用。triggerOn:"mousemove",//提示框触发的条件,'mousemove'鼠标移动时触发。'click'鼠标点击时触发。'mousemove|click'同时鼠标移动和点击时触发。'none'不在'mousemove'或'click'时触发showContent:true,//是否显示提示框浮层alwaysShow
我正在使用角控制器中的jQuery工具提示。我需要以粗体样式显示一些工具提示内容。我尝试了以下内容功能,这给出了一些错误。jQuery(function(){jQuery(document).tooltip({tooltipClass:"custToolTip",style:{height:300,overflow:'auto'},position:{my:"left-50bottom-15",at:"bottomright",collision:'none'}content:function(){returnjQuery(this).prop('title');}});});添加该内容元素后
目录🌟Echarts配置项🌟Echarts配置项之`title组件`🌟Echarts配置项之`legend组件`🌟Echarts配置项之`tooltip组件`🌟Echarts配置项之`toolbox组件`🌟写在最后🌟Echarts配置项ECharts开源来自百度商业前端数据可视化团队,基于html5Canvas,是一个纯Javascript图表库,提供直观,生动,可交互,可个性化定制的数据可视化图表。创新的拖拽重计算、数据视图、值域漫游等特性大大增强了用户体验,赋予了用户对数据进行挖掘、整合的能力。想让ECharts展示出我们预期的效果,就要在myChart.setOption()方法中传入一
一、图例自定义 实现效果://首先引入importorangeIconfrom'../../../../assets/images/class_statistical/icon1.png';//使用legend:{show:true,data:[{name:'本班及格率',icon:'image://'+blueIcon+''},{name:'年级及格率',icon:'image://'+orangeIcon+''}],x:'right',y:'top',itemWidth:40,itemHeight:13,itemGap:40,//间距}虽然上面实现了图例自定义,但是仔细看会发现图例与文字不
引入js文件import{autoHover}from‘./tooltip’/***echartstooltip轮播*@paramchartECharts实例*@paramchartOptionecharts的配置信息*@paramoptionsobject选项*{*interval轮播时间间隔,单位毫秒,默认为3000*true表示循环所有series的tooltip,false则显示指定seriesIndex的tooltip*seriesIndex默认为0,指定某个系列(option中的series索引)循环显示tooltip,*当loopSeries为true时,从seriesIndex